The latest finds up here in the Norhteast
Location: Home Depot: Nothing at all....boo hoo!
Location: Massachusetts: Somerville Lumber (sort of a sad attempt at Home
Depot)
Plano #3700 storage trays polypropolene- approx capacity 170 EMDE/ALBION or
any mount with EMDE binder, 180 RBT, 400 + cardboard or aluminum foldover.
7.49 ea
Plano Model 974 "Stowaway"- contains 4 Plano #3700 drawers in a nice pull out
access cabinet...no front door on it , you can see the trays. If you stacked
your 3700's you could get 5 of them in place of the cabinet that holds
4.....for those with space considerations. on a mangers special at 19.99
ea...best value on the 3700 that I found.
Location: K-Mart: Somerville Mass
"attention K-Mart Shoppers...time to go fishing!" everyone...here is the
latest for you all trawlin' for 3-D storage. Go to the sporting good section
Plano #1232 this is a smaller version of the #1234 below, but it carries
three trays, sideways, and has room for at least a couple of viewers....nice.
costs 17.95 (not sure this is right, this store was a mess)
Plano #1234 "Guide"- this "mission control"" sized unit holds three #3700
trays, has ample room for a few viewers and 3-D stuff, I like this for the
trip when you want to bring stuff to mount.... #3700 trays are stored
sideways....not my idea of long term storage, OK temporarily while
travelling,....not on an airplane though....too bulky to carry on...unless
you are going to make it the only thing you carry on, you may have to put it
somewhere other than overhead.
Cost 32.97
Plano #1148- Neat little unit, fixed carrying trays back to back as you
carry it like a briefcase, if you have it on a table, one tray is face
up...the other face down....two latching mechanisms hold the lid down on the
trays. Did not get capacity, a little smaller than the Plano #3700....no
polypropolene symbol on this one though. Cost 12.99
"Attention K-Mart Shoppers...In the tool and automotive section....
Stack-On DS-18 Looking for lots of storage space, don't need to carry the
stuff out of the house, not ultimately concerned about the polypropolene
factor?.... this is a neat unit.
Eighteen drawers, each has four fixed compartments... enough vert & horiz.
room to keep slides in KODAK slide box sized boxes.
Holds llllots of slides...no polypropolene designation...drawers have about
1/8in spacing above and below each other...meaning that air and dust can pass
through here. Still a nice unit. Cost 17.99
